The nickel(II) complexes of the compositions [Ni(hmidtc)(bpy)2]ClO4 (I), [Ni(hmidtc)(phen)2]ClO4 (II), [Ni(hmidtc)(phen)2]SCN (III), [Ni(hmidtc)(phen)2]PF6 (IV), [Ni(hmidtc)(phen)2]BPh4 (V), [Ni(hmidtc)(phen)2]AcO·2H2O (VI) and [Ni(hmidtc)(phen)2]Br·H2O (VII), involving a combination of one hexamethyleneimine-dithiocarbamate anion (hmidtc) and two bidentate N,N-donor ligands (2,2′-bipyridine (bpy) for I or 1,10-phenanthroline (phen) for II–VII), have been prepared. The compounds were characterized by elemental analysis, molar conductivity measurements, UV–Vis and IR spectroscopy, magnetochemical measurements and thermal analysis. A single-crystal X-ray analysis of the complex I revealed a distorted octahedral geometry with the nickel(II) ion coordinated by four nitrogen atoms (from two bidentate-coordinated bpy molecules) and two sulfur atoms (from one bidentate-coordinated hmidtc anion), together giving an NiN4S2 donor set.
